Phrase Announce New Machine Translation Engine: Phrase NextMT
Phrase has announced Phrase NextMT, its internally-developed neural machine translation engine, as a core new capability of the recently announced Phrase Localization Suite.
Neural machine translation is state-of-the-art approach to automated language translation. The technology deploys neural networks to convert language.
